您可以使用命令列介面在 OpenStack 管理伺服器上匯入映像。

支援下列映像格式:

  • VMDK

  • ISO

  • OVA

若要以其他格式上傳映像,請參閱以不支援的格式匯入映像

備註:

ISO 映像無法用於建立磁碟區。

程序

  1. viouser 身分登入 OpenStack 管理伺服器
  2. 切換至 root 使用者,然後載入雲端管理員認證檔案。
    sudo su -
    source ~/cloudadmin.rc
  3. 在 Glance 中建立映像。
    glance image-create --name image-name --file image-path --disk-format {vmdk | iso} --container_format bare --visibility {public | private} [--property vmware_adaptertype="adapter-type"] [--property vmware_disktype="disk-type"] [--property vmware_ostype="operating-system"]

    選項

    說明

    --name

    輸入映像服務中映像檔的名稱。

    --file

    輸入所需映像檔的路徑。

    --disk_format

    輸入來源映像的磁碟格式。您可以指定 isovmdk

    對於 OVA 格式的映像,請使用 vmdk 做為磁碟格式。

    --container_format

    輸入 bare。容器格式引數目前不是由 Glance 使用。

    --visibility

    輸入 public 使映像可供所有使用者使用,或輸入 private 使映像僅供目前使用者使用。

    --property vmware_adaptertype

    指定 VMDK 磁碟的介面卡類型。

    如果不包括此參數,介面卡類型由 Introspection 決定。

    備註:
    • 對於使用半虛擬化介面卡的磁碟,請包括此參數並將其設為 paraVirtual

    • 對於使用 LSI Logic SAS 介面卡的磁碟,請包括此參數並將其設為 lsiLogicsas

    --property vmware_disktype

    指定 sparsepreallocatedstreamOptimized

    如果不包括此參數,磁碟類型由 Introspection 決定。

    --property vmware_ostype

    指定映像上的作業系統。

下一步

您可以執行 glance image-list 命令以查看部署中映像的名稱和狀態。

承租人可以使用已匯入的映像啟動 OpenStack 執行個體。如需相關指示,請參閱〈從映像啟動 OpenStack 執行個體〉